Transaction 5326451433c08e7e096942a71ddcb5316febb48ae6d98a4668ae2a3547096bcb

3 Input
2 Outputs
  • 5326451433c08e7e096942a71ddcb5316febb48ae6d98a4668ae2a3547096bcb:0
  • value  7836575
    address  1KScE7jhHHN54ric3n4H5tXvnRpcAU7ife
  • 5326451433c08e7e096942a71ddcb5316febb48ae6d98a4668ae2a3547096bcb:1
  • value  993483
    address  3JsTxETs1mzPjhnZ21zSJtctQENfYCLHKG